Lewis And Clark Trust Inc
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 16,200 | 2,009 | 14,191 | 84.8 | — |
| 2013 | 49,326 | 27,269 | 22,057 | 16.0 | — |
| 2014 | 24,339 | 38,020 | −13,681 | 7.1 | — |
| 2015 | 12,388 | 28,779 | −16,391 | 2.6 | — |
| 2016 | 37,700 | 26,931 | 10,769 | 7.6 | — |
| 2017 | 62,533 | 26,085 | 36,448 | 24.6 | — |
| 2018 | 15,290 | 10,850 | 4,440 | 64.0 | — |
| 2019 | 22,285 | 12,706 | 9,579 | 63.7 | — |
| 2020 | 21,132 | 4,952 | 16,180 | 200.3 | — |
| 2021 | 24,849 | 4,108 | 20,741 | 289.9 | — |
| 2022 | 141,512 | 69,460 | 72,052 | 29.6 | — |
| 2023 | 76,164 | 138,434 | −62,270 | 9.5 | — |
| 2024 | 97,334 | 135,975 | −38,641 | 6.2 | — |
In its most recent public year (2024), this organization spent $38,641 more than it brought in. Its reserves stood at about 6.2 months of spending, down from 84.8 in 2012.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2024.
